1. Evernote
Evernote is a powerful note-taking app that enables students to capture and organize notes, ideas, and to-do lists. It allows for:
- Text notes, images, audio notes, and web clippings.
- Organizing notes into notebooks and using tags for easy retrieval.
- Syncing across all devices, ensuring you'll have your notes available anytime.
2. Quizlet
Quizlet is an interactive study tool that allows students to create digital flashcards for various subjects. Key features include:
- Customizable study sets for different topics.
- Game-like modes to make studying engaging and fun.
- Accessible on mobile devices, making it perfect for on-the-go review.
3. Google Keep
Google Keep is a simple yet effective app for organizing notes, lists, and reminders. Its advantages include:
- Easy integration with other Google services, like Calendar and Drive.
- Collaborative features for group study sessions.
- Voice notes and image notes for flexible note-taking.
4. Forest
Forest is a unique app designed to help students stay focused by avoiding distractions. With this app, students can:
- Grow a virtual tree while they study, representing time spent focused.
- Track progress in maintaining focus over time.
- Earn rewards to unlock new tree species and plant real trees.
5. Khan Academy
Khan Academy offers a vast library of educational videos and exercises in multiple subjects. This app provides:
- Free lessons and resources in mathematics, science, history, and more.
- Ability to learn at your own pace with personalized learning dashboards.
- Access to various practice exercises to reinforce learning.
